Airfoil designs are crucial for the aerodynamic performance of airplanes. Multiple objectives under several flight conditions to satisfy engineering requirements, especially for wide-speed-range aircraft or morphing aircraft are always considered. Airfoil generative design method is an end-to-end method which inputs design objectives and outputs airfoil geometry directly. In this study, a novel airfoil generative design method using a conditional denoising diffusion probabilistic model was developed to solve the multi-objective design problem.
